Business Scope of Attic Mold Remediation:
Market Demand:
- Homeowners, property managers, and real estate agents increasingly recognize the importance of addressing mold issues, especially in attics where moisture and poor ventilation can lead to mold growth. The growing awareness of mold-related health risks fuels the demand for effective remediation services.
Residential and Commercial Opportunities:
- The business scope of attic mold remediation extends to a wide range of properties, including single-family homes, multi-unit residences, commercial buildings, and rental properties. Professionals in this field have the opportunity to serve diverse clients and address varying mold remediation needs.
Health and Safety Compliance:
- With stringent regulations governing mold remediation practices and a focus on ensuring indoor air quality, businesses specializing in attic mold remediation play a crucial role in safeguarding occupants' health and well-being. Compliance with health and safety standards is paramount in this industry.
